Transaction e55ba0b86f249707f72e12f36cb16522e51b74ab0c587cc7210624cd6d23cdbb
1 Input
1 Output
-
e55ba0b86f249707f72e12f36cb16522e51b74ab0c587cc7210624cd6d23cdbb:0
- value
- 2443742
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ab51eb7f37998f01449b3070c34d466a3d29dafb OP_EQUAL
- address
- 3HJscEywxiaq1yG3Tt2vxAPYbvzps54sKV